WHY IS IT IMPORTANT TO MEASURE THE INTERNAL RESISTANCE OF A FORKLIFT BATTERY?

Author:BSLBATT    Publish Time: 2023-08-29

The internal resistance of a battery plays a crucial role in regulating the flow of voltage and determining the overall performance of the battery. Often referred to as the "gatekeeper," it acts as a barrier that restricts the delivery of voltage and influences the battery's runtime. This internal resistance is not a fixed value but is instead calculated based on several factors such as the battery's size, state of charge, age of the cells, temperature, internal chemistry, and current discharge. It is typically measured in milliohms, which provides a quantitative measure of the resistance.


Understanding the concept of internal resistance becomes particularly important when dealing with lift truck batteries. By comprehending the internal resistance of these batteries, one can make informed decisions when choosing between different power sources. This knowledge allows for a more efficient selection process, ensuring that the chosen battery is capable of meeting the specific requirements of the lift truck. Additionally, monitoring the internal resistance over time provides valuable insights into the battery's state of health and performance. By tracking this data, potential issues can be identified early on, allowing for timely maintenance or replacement, thus minimizing downtime and maximizing productivity.


The internal resistance of a lift truck battery is influenced by various factors. The size of the battery, for instance, can impact the internal resistance, with larger batteries generally exhibiting lower resistance. The state of charge also plays a role, as a fully charged battery tends to have lower internal resistance compared to a partially charged one. The age of the cells within the battery can also affect the internal resistance, with older cells typically exhibiting higher resistance. Temperature is another crucial factor, as extreme temperatures can increase the internal resistance and reduce the overall performance of the battery. Lastly, the internal chemistry and current discharge of the battery contribute to its internal resistance. By considering all these parameters, one can gain a comprehensive understanding of the internal resistance of a lift truck battery and make informed decisions regarding its usage and maintenance.


HOW TO FIND VOLTAGE DROP IN A BATTERY

When electrical current is flowing through a circuit, the voltage output is always lower than the input - that difference is known as the voltagedrop.

Voltage drop is the product of current and resistance - so by understanding the amount of voltage drop, you can determine how energyefficient your battery.

The lower the internal resistance, the better the battery performance is. The higher internal resistance in a battery, the more the battery willheat up creating a voltage drop.
